The Role
Operational :
- Responsible for the operational remit of on-boarding new system users.
- Ongoing management of health and social care professionals using software platforms to access and order Community Equipment.
- Liaising with Provider organisations to maintain the PIN Matrix that supports prescriber team analysis of spend.
- Managing the daily queries and being the first point of contact for new users.
- Being responsible for the creation, amendment and disabling of accounts.
- Dealing with general queries and issues from users and escalating (where required) to the senior health and social care leads.
- Establishing the operational management of prescriber communications and being responsible for receiving and uploading documents.
Analytical :
- Establishing and understanding Business Intelligence software.
- Assisting and creating reporting around business themes, not exhaustive to: Spend / Activity / KPIs & Quality.
- Providing analytical support where required.
- Supporting Operations Support Manager in engagement programs
